#397bdc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#397bdc is composed of 22.4% red, 48.2% green and 86.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 74.1% cyan, 44.1% magenta, 0% yellow and 13.7% black. It has a hue angle of 215.7 degrees, a saturation of 70% and a lightness of 54.3%. #397bdc color hex could be obtained by blending #72f6ff with #0000b9. Closest websafe color is: #3366cc.

#397bdc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#397bdc has RGB values of R:57, G:123, B:220 and CMYK values of C:0.74, M:0.44, Y:0, K:0.14. Its decimal value is 3767260.

Shades and Tints of #397bdc

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000102 is the darkest color, while #f0f5fc is the lightest one.

Tones of #397bdc

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#8a8a8b is the less saturated color, while #1e76f7 is the most saturated one.
